‘Boys Go To Jupiter’: Janeane Garofalo Joins Tribeca Bound Animated Feature From Julian Glander
Image
Exclusive: Boys Go to Jupiter, the debut feature film from acclaimed indie animator Julian Glander, has finalized its cast ahead of its Tribeca Film Festival premiere in June. Newly added to the lineup are Janeane Garofalo and Demi Adeyujigbe.

The cast also includes Jack Corbett (NPR’s Planet Money TikTok) Elsie Fisher (Eighth Grade) Tavi Gevinson (Gossip Girl), Julio Torres (Los Espookys), Sarah Sherman (SNL), Joe Pera (Joe Pera Talks With You), Grace Kuhlenschmidt (The Daily Show), Singer-songwriter Miya Folick, as well as comedians Demi Adeyuijigbe, Chris Fleming, Cole Escola, River L. Ramirez, Eva Victor, and Max Wittert.

Boys Go to Jupiter is billed as a surreal animated coming-of-age story, brought to life in Glander’s trademark 3D visual style and sonic palette. The film follows a week in the life of a teenager in suburban Florida as he hustles his way through a series of bizarre gig economy errands.

Julio Torres’ ‘Problemista’ Starring Tilda Swinton & RZA Gets Release Date From A24
Image
A24 has set March 1 for the limited release of the Julio Torres-directed feature Problemista, with the title going wide on March 22. A special video release announcement featuring Torres and his co-star Tilda Swinton can be found above.

The feature was originally set to premiere in August but was delayed due to the dual WGA and SAG-AFTRA strikes.

Julio Torres and Tilda Swinton in ‘Problemista’

The surreal adventure Problemista follows Alejandro (Torres), an aspiring toy designer from El Salvador struggling to bring his unusual ideas to life in New York City. As time on his work visa runs out, a job assisting an erratic art-world outcast Elizabeth (Swinton) becomes his only hope to stay in the country and realize his dream. Problemista is described as a surreal adventure through the equally treacherous worlds of New York City and the U.S. Immigration system.

Comedian Julio Torres Partners With Ars Nova On Artist Incubator Program, Will Return To Its Stage As Host Of ‘Showgasm.’ In October
Image
Exclusive: Comedic multi-hyphenate Julio Torres (A24’s Problemista) has struck a deal with Ars Nova, the Off-Broadway, non-profit theater in NYC, that will see them partner to identify, develop, and commission full-length projects from early-career comedy artists.

The collaboration further expands Ars Nova’s two-decade commitment to new comedy at a time when support systems for NYC-based artists have decreased. Under the partnership, Torres and Ars Nova will look to provide comedians with opportunities for development and production outside of the traditional model of sketch shows and 10-minute sets. They’ll offer funding up front to create brand new, uniquely theatrical shows, while providing mentorship and development resources to the artists involved, the first set for a commission being Ars Nova Vision Residency Alum River L. Ramirez. Others will be announced at a later date.

To celebrate the alliance, Torres will return to the Ars Nova stage on October 26 to host Showgasm.

A24 Pauses ‘Problemista’ August Theatrical Release Due To Strikes
Image
Exclusive: In light of the current strikes, A24 is pausing the release of Julio Torres’ Problemista which was set to launch limited on Aug. 4. The new release date will be determined down the road. The studio is doing this to support filmmaker Torres, furthermore these awards-type indie movies need their stars, Tilda Swinton here, available to do press and raise such fare’s profile.

Problemista is the second August release after Lionsgate’s White Bird to move off its opening date; that pic originally scheduled for a limited release on Aug. 18. It’s obvious the SAG-AFTRA strike is having a more immediate upending impact than anticipated. Studios are able to pivot with these movies at the last minute as they do not have long-lead tentpole campaigns with big TV spends.

The movie made its world premiere out of SXSW where it notched 91% fresh on Rotten Tomatoes.

‘Los Espookys’ Canceled at HBO After 2 Seasons
Image
“Los Espookys,” HBO’s Spanish-language comedy series, has been canceled after two seasons at the network, IndieWire has confirmed.

Created by Julio Torres, Ana Fabrega, and Fred Armisen, “Los Espookys” focused on a group of aimless friends who turn their love of the horror genre into a business where they trick people into thinking the supernatural is real. All three co-creators starred in the series along with Bernardo Velasco and Cassandra Ciangherotti as the Espookys. The show initially premiered in 2019, then went on a pandemic-induced, three-year hiatus before premiering its second season this past September.

“We are thrilled we could deliver the unique and hilarious second season of ‘Los Espookys’ to viewers finally, more than three years after the series premiere, due to pandemic delays,” HBO said in a statement. “We thank Julio, Ana and Fred for this imaginative and delightfully bizarre world they created. National Lampoon's Lemmings Rebooted for a New Generation
Tony Sokol Jan 28, 2020

National Lampoon finds corporate sponsors for its Downfall Festival in Lemmings: 21st Century.

National Lampoon flayed the peace and love generation when a million Lemmings showed up to off themselves at a free concert. The National Lampoon franchise, which is celebrating its 50th anniversary, will send a new wave over the cliff. The iconic comedy brand is rebooting their legendary Off-Broadway Show with Lemmings: 21st Century.

Lemmings was a take-off of Woodstock, promising three days of peace, love and death. John Belushi was the master of ceremonies, bassist, and suicidal cheerleader for the “Woodshuck" festival. The new original musical picks up where the original left off by spoofing the corporate festival culture which has taken over musical gatherings ever since. National Lampoon President Talks the Return of Radio Hour
Tony Sokol Dec 17, 2019

National Lampoon Radio Hour version 2.0 will recreate the relevance of irreverence, promises Evan Shapiro.

National Lampoon magazine will celebrate its 50th anniversary in 2020, and its sonic counterpart, the National Lampoon Radio Hour is being rebooted for the 21st century. Starting on Dec. 19, the iconic sketch comedy troupe which introduced the world to John Belushi, Bill Murray, Chevy Chase, Harold Ramis, Christopher Guest, and Gilda Radner will produce a new, original 11-episode scripted podcast.

The new National Lampoon Radio Hour is being shaped by head writer Cole Escola and senior writer Jo Firestone. It will be performed by a new generation of groundbreaking comedians coming from the New York alt-comedy scene. The podcast will also feature guest comedians Rachel Dratch, Amy Sedaris, Julie Klausner, Jordan Klepper and Chris Gethard.
